Mean and median income by household type - two adults younger than 65 years - mean equivalised net income - euro reached 18,666 Euro in 2015 in Malta, according to Eurostat, SILC. This is 3.00% more than in the previous year.

Historically, Mean and median income by household type - Two adults younger than 65 years - Mean equivalised net income - Euro in Malta reached an all time high of 18,666 Euro in 2015 and an all time low of 11,595 Euro in 2005.

Malta has been ranked 17th within the group of 32 countries we follow in terms of Mean and median income by household type - Two adults younger than 65 years - Mean equivalised net income - Euro.
